As a expert in your field, you're undoubtedly skilled and dedicated to your craft. But financial literacy is equally crucial for long-term success. Develop a robust understanding of personal finance principles to build financial stability and freedom. Start by creating a comprehensive budget, monitoring your income and expenses meticulously. Research various investment options that suit your risk tolerance and financial goals. Don't hesitate to partner with a qualified financial advisor who can provide customized guidance based on your unique circumstances.
- Focus on emergency savings to navigate unforeseen financial challenges.
- Minimize unnecessary spending and discover areas where you can conserve costs.
- Analyze your insurance coverage regularly to ensure it covers your current needs.
By adopting these strategies, you can manage your finances effectively and pave the way for a prosperous future.
